Enter to Beko 42 Plasma TV Service Menu Mode
PA Chassis Version 1.0
Entering the service menu with user remote control;
Enter  key “1972” when main menu appears on the screen.
Use channel button to navigate and use volume button to change the value settings.

Beko 42 Plasma TV Service Menu
Brightness
Mode
Auto To adjust the general brightness
RS232 Setting 19200 Slip speed for software downloads
Customer Logo X To choose the customer logo, if available (1, 2, etc.)
Operation Time - Shows the operation time since first switch on, can be resetted by
technician
Default Color
Settings
- To adjust the general color settings, normal value is: RGB offset 7
and RGB gain 128
Power On Input Last Defines which input is active after switching on the unit
Temperature
Setting
- Shows temperature threshold for temperature alert function:
Temp1: 60°C; Temp2: 65°C; Temp3: 63°C
also shows all time Max and Min temperature, which can be
resetted by technician
Full Mask off Available functions: inverted, red, green, blue, full white. Might
help against Burn In
Sub Volume - Defines volume setting of each single input separately
Version /
System Info
- Soft-/Hardware version
Reset
Everything
Resets all settings to factory defaults, also erases all channel
settings

General Guidance Beko 42 Plasma TV
An lsolation Transformer should always be used during the servicing of a receiver whose chassis is not isolated from the AC power line. Use a transformer of adequate power rating as this protects the technician from accidents resulting in personal injury from electrical shocks.
It will also protect the receiver and it's components from being damaged by accidental shorts of the circuitary that may be inadvertently introduced during the service operation.
If any fuse (or Fusible Resistor) in this monitor is blown, replace it with the specified.
When replacing a high wattage resistor (Oxide Metal Film Resistor, over 1W), keep the resistor 10mm away from PCB.
Keep wires away from high voltage or high temperature parts
